Hello,
I'm going to add iron ladders to my mod. 
 

I created a class:

package ...

import ...

public class BlockIronLadder extends BlockLadder {
    public BlockIronLadder() {

        setUnlocalizedName("iron_ladder");
        setRegistryName("iron_ladder");

        BlockInit.BLOCKS.add(this);
        ItemInit.ITEMS.add(new ItemBlock(this).setRegistryName(this.getRegistryName()));
    }
}

And called it in my BlockInit:

public static final Block IRON_LADDER = new BlockIronLadder();

And successfully registered the block and the item to the game.

 

I also created all of the following JSON files:

assets/blockstates/iron_ladder.json
{
    "variants": {
        "facing=north": { "model": "iron_ladder" },
        "facing=east":  { "model": "iron_ladder", "y": 90 },
        "facing=south": { "model": "iron_ladder", "y": 180 },
        "facing=west":  { "model": "iron_ladder", "y": 270 }
    }
}
assets/models/block/iron_ladder.json
{
    "ambientocclusion": false,
    "textures": {
        "particle": "blocks/iron_ladder",
        "texture": "blocks/iron_ladder"
    },
    "elements": [
        {   "from": [ 0, 0, 15.2 ],
            "to": [ 16, 16, 15.2 ],
            "shade": false,
            "faces": {
                "north": { "uv": [ 0, 0, 16, 16 ], "texture": "#texture" },
                "south": { "uv": [ 0, 0, 16, 16 ], "texture": "#texture" }
            }
        }
    ]
}
assets/models/item/iron_ladder.json
{
  "parent": "item/generated",
  "textures": {
    "layer0": "blocks/iron_ladder"
  }
}

 

...and the texture:

assets/textures/blocks/iron_ladder.png


I added a record to the lang file as well:

tile.iron_ladder.name=Iron Ladder


The ladder works fine, but shows up as...
a pink-black cube with the texture_name#variant_name
scr1.png

[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]: +=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]: The following texture errors were found.
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]: ==================================================
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]:   DOMAIN minecraft
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]: --------------------------------------------------
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]:   domain minecraft is missing 1 texture
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]:     domain minecraft has 3 locations:
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]:       unknown resourcepack type net.minecraft.client.resources.DefaultResourcePack : Default
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]:       unknown resourcepack type net.minecraft.client.resources.LegacyV2Adapter : FMLFileResourcePack:Forge Mod Loader
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]:       unknown resourcepack type net.minecraft.client.resources.LegacyV2Adapter : FMLFileResourcePack:Minecraft Forge
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]: -------------------------
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]:     The missing resources for domain minecraft are:
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]:       textures/blocks/iron_ladder.png
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]: -------------------------
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]:     No other errors exist for domain minecraft
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]: ==================================================
[06:56:04] [main/ERROR] [TEXTURE ERRORS]: +=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=+=

 

Am I missing something..? Well, surely I do, but what is it...?

3 hours ago, Xander402 said:

 


{
  "parent": "item/generated",
  "textures": {
    "layer0": "blocks/iron_ladder"
  }
}

 

Your texture path is missing a domain (mod id), so Minecraft thinks you are looking for "blocks/iron_ladder" in the vanilla Minecraft assets, which does contain a texture for "iron_ladder".

Change "blocks/iron_ladder" to "modid:blocks/iron_ladder"

So far you've only added a model for your block when placed in world; you did not add a model for your block as an item.

 

What you need to do is to add a iron_ladder.json in your models/item. In the ladder's case, the item should be a child of item/generated with the iron_ladder.png as the texture.

 

Since the model for ladder is flat, you can just add it like how you would add an item.

 

{
    "parent": "item/generated",
    "textures": {
        "layer0": "modid:items/iron_ladder"
    }
}

 

EDIT: send your iron_ladder.json in your model/item folder. You should also check your console to see if any missing textures are reported.
